He’s 9 1/2. They checked his height and everyone ziplining has to check their weight to make sure they’re within the safe range for the equipment. We found online that the guidelines are 52” or more and 75-275lbs but that’s not on the official RCCL page so it may have changed. Thanks for watching!

Hi! Sorry, what ages were your kids here! I have a 3 and half and a 5 year old and want them to be together. I was wondering if my little one is too young for the Oceaneer club
Good news! Ages 3-10 are together in the Oceaneers Club (with plenty of different spaces so the big kids and little kids often choose different areas but don’t really have to.) As long as your littlest is fully potty trained they should be in the club together. I hope that helps! Have a GREAT cruise!

If i went to the service desk at the front of the parks could i find out all the options available to my allergies in the park? I've been and felt super overwhelmed going to each restaurant or fast food area and asking. It takes a long time to find out and then my day at the park is shortened by the time I spend hunting for something to eat.
I totally understand how much time it takes and how overwhelming that is. Your magical time in the parks is limited and you don’t want to waste it! But Guest Services in the park aren’t going to have the most up-to-date info, as menus are changing all the time (we had items we were planning on getting last week disappear from the menu the week before our trip!) Your best bet is to research beforehand using menus in the app (scroll to the last section for allergy info) or finding accounts that specialize in this. I usually use GlutenFreeDairyFreeAtWDW or GlutenFreeDisney (who also specifies when things are vegan) either here or on IG. You can book 120 days in advance of your sailing (or 135 days prior if you are a RockStar). I have seen that some “shore things” (Virgin’s name for excursions) do book up, so it does matter!
